~~ MOUNTAIN COAL <br />COMPANY~.~.~. <br />A Subsidiary of Arch Western Resoiuces, I,I,C <br />June 6, 2007 <br />RECEIVED <br />JUN 11 2007 <br />Division o1 reclamation, <br />Mining and Safety <br />West Elk Mine <br />POBOx 591 <br />5174 Highway 133 <br />Somerset, CO 81434 <br />(970) 929-50] 5 <br />Fax (970) 929-5595 <br />Mr. Tom Kaldenbach <br />Colorado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ety (CDRMS) <br />Office of Mined Land Reclamation <br />1313 Sherman Street, Room 215 <br />Denver, Colorado 80203 <br />Re: Mountain Coal Company LLC (MCC), West Elk Mine, Permit No. C-80-007; Minor Revision No. <br />343 (MR-343), Methane Drainage Well No. 25-11.5, Sylvester Gulch (Private Property). <br />Dear Mr. Kaldenbach, <br />MCC is submitting this Minor Revision for one methane drainage well in Sylvester Gulch for Pane125 B Seam. <br />The well will be constructed on private property on previously disturbed ground. Access to the site will be by <br />an existing light-use road constructed in 1997. Because the depth of the well is relatively shallow (400 feet) <br />and the direction is oriented vertically, a small mudpit will need to be constructed. The mudpit designs, would <br />most likely be fora 0.5 acre pad as previously submitted in Technical Revision No. 101, (TR-101). <br />MCC is submitting to the Division a corrected Map 53B and a typica125 Panel MDW Well Design in order for <br />the CDRMS to approve Minor Revision No. 343.
